Energy saving within the fishing fleet is a priority area within the Fisheries and Aquaculture Research Fund (FHF). Against this background, the project has been initiated at SINTEF Fisheries and Aquaculture with the aim of contributing to the implementation of measures for reducing energy consumption within the fishing fleet. The project will develop better competence, among other things by obtaining existing relevant technology from other disciplines and new concrete concepts and systems will be developed.
